Many children and young people with additional needs often encounter behaviour difficulties.  Challenging behaviour can have a huge impact on the lives of the family. Dealing with challenging behaviour can leave parents and practitioners feeling exhausted and frustrated.

Scope’s Time 2 Behave workshop provides innovative training, written by a specialist SEN teacher and consultant. The aim is to train parents and professionals together in partnership and to explore ideas that will help to support them to manage difficult behaviours more effectively.

This one day sleep workshop includes: 

  • Impact of Challenging Behaviour 
  • Using Positive Language
  • Triggers for Behaviour   
  • Reward Systems
  • Behaviour Diaries  
  • Managing Behaviours Effectively
  • Useful Resources 
  • Looking After Yourself
